from smolagents import CodeAgent, HfApiModel, tool, DuckDuckGoSearchTool, MLXModel


@tool
def add(a:int, b:int) -> int:
  """
  This tool returns the sum of two numbers.

  Args:
    a: first number
    b: second number
  """

  return a+b


@tool
def subtract(a:int, b:int) -> int:
  """
  This tool returns the difference between two numbers.

  Args:
    a: first number
    b: second number
  """

  return a-b


@tool
def multiply(a:int, b:int) -> int:
  """
  This tool multiplies two numbers.

  Args:
    a: first number
    b: second number
  """

  return a*b


@tool
def divide(a:int, b:int) -> float:
  """
  This tool divides two numbers.

  Args:
    a: first number
    b: second number
  """

  if b==0: raise ValueError('Cannot divide by zero')
  return a/b


@tool
def modulus(a:int, b:int) -> int:
  """
  This tool returns the modulus of two numbers.

  Args:
    a: first number
    b: second number
  """

  return a%b


@tool
def rounder(a:float, n:int) -> float:
  """
  This tool return a number rounded to a certain number of decimals.

  Args:
    a: number to be rounded
    n: number of decimals to use when rounding the number
  """

  return round(a,n)


def get_agent() -> CodeAgent:
  search_tool = DuckDuckGoSearchTool()

  model = MLXModel(
    "mlx-community/Qwen2.5-Coder-32B-Instruct-4bit",
    {
        "temperature": 0.7,
        "top_k": 20,  
        "top_p": 0.8, 
        "min_p": 0.05,
        "num_ctx": 32768,
    },
)

  return CodeAgent(tools=[add, subtract, multiply, divide, modulus, rounder, search_tool], model=model)
